Senior Backend Engineer

About Plenful

Plenful is on a mission to transform healthcare operations from the inside out. Fresh off our $50M Series B and backed by Bessemer Venture Partners, Notable Capital, TQ Ventures, Susa/Kivu Ventures, and other leading investors, we’re building the category-defining AI agentic operating platform that healthcare teams rely on to operate smarter, faster, and more efficiently. Our technology empowers healthcare operators across hospital and health systems, pharmacies and payors to eliminate manual work, reduce administrative burden, and improve compliance, all while unlocking critical revenue to fund programs for their in-need patient populations.


Built by healthcare operators for healthcare operators, Plenful is driven by a deep understanding of the challenges facing today’s care teams. We’re passionate about equipping healthcare workers with world-class tools that deliver real, measurable impact, and we’re proud to serve leading healthcare organizations across the country. If you’re excited to help shape the future of healthcare, we’d love to meet you. Apply now to join our growing team.


About the role
We’re looking for a Senior Backend Engineer to design and build systems that power our distributed computing, data workflows, and core infrastructure. You’ll take ownership of major backend components, contribute to database and orchestration architecture, and collaborate closely with our DevOps and ML teams. This role is ideal for an experienced engineer who loves solving complex technical problems, improving system reliability, and contributing to the evolution of a high-performing backend platform.

What you’ll do
Core Infrastructure & Workflow Orchestration

  • Contribute to the design and evolution of our workflow orchestration system that runs across serverless and containerized environments, processing millions of tasks each month.
  • Implement scheduling, queuing, rate limiting, and retry logic for reliable and fair resource allocation.
  • Build components for state tracking, error handling, timeouts, and cleanup across distributed tasks.
  • Collaborate with DevOps to enhance observability, structured logging, tracing, and deployment automation.

Database Architecture & Data Modeling

  • Design and optimize schemas for scalable and flexible data storage.
  • Improve query performance and efficiency across large datasets through indexing, caching, and connection pooling.
  • Ensure data integrity, concurrency control, and compliance with data governance standards.
  • Support replication, backups, and disaster recovery efforts in partnership with DevOps.

External Integrations & Data Pipelines

  • Build and maintain integrations with SFTP, email, databases, spreadsheets, and REST APIs, including credential management and failure recovery.
  • Develop and operate file processing pipelines handling high data volumes across diverse formats (PDF, Excel, CSV, JSON).
  • Work with healthcare data formats (HL7, X12, EDI) and collaborate with ML/AI teams on data pipelines for model training and inference.
  • Create and maintain webhook handlers, polling services, and event-driven workflows.

Technical Impact & Collaboration

  • Take ownership of complex backend projects from design through deployment.
  • Participate in architectural discussions, propose improvements, and help drive high reliability and maintainability standards.
  • Contribute to reducing technical debt and improving operational efficiency.
  • Mentor junior engineers through code reviews and technical discussions.
  • Participate in incident response and postmortems with a focus on prevention and system resilience.

What we’re looking for

  • 5+ years of professional software engineering experience.
  • Solid experience with distributed systems, workflow orchestration, and large-scale backend development.
  • Strong database expertise: SQL, schema design, and performance optimization.
  • Solid computer science fundamentals (data structures, algorithms, system design).
  • Experience with large-scale data pipelines and external integrations.
  • Ability to take ownership of projects and collaborate effectively across engineering, DevOps, and ML teams.
  • Proven experience improving reliability, performance, and maintainability in production systems.
  • Strong communication skills for technical discussions and documentation.

Plenful perks

  • Great benefits include unlimited PTO, health insurance, meal stipend, health & wellness stipend, team offsites, 401K matching, and stock options
  • Opportunities to further develop and refine your partnership acumen by partnering with our seasoned leaders

#LI-DNI 

Engineering

Hybrid (San Francisco, California, US)

Share on:

Terms of servicePrivacyCookiesPowered by Rippling